Abstract
The invention discloses a three-network integration transitional voice communication method and a three-network integration transitional signalling system. The system comprises a number integration signalling subsystem for generating a pseudo-public switched telephone network (PSTN) number at the internet protocol (IP) end by taking a PSTN number at a PSTN end of an international standard serial number (ISSN) user terminal, so that the pseudo-PSTN number is used as an identification number for establishing interconnection and intercommunication call between the ISSN user terminal and a PSTN telephone network user terminal, wherein the ISSN user terminal comprises an ISSN terminal signalling platform, and also comprises a sharing user gateway signalling subsystem, a crossing network strategy signalling subsystem and a user gateway signalling subsystem. By the three-network integration transitional voice communication method and the three-network integration transitional signalling system, the ISSN user terminal and the conventional PSTN telephone network user terminal perform interconnection and intercommunication of two-way call on the voice level in a three-network integration communication system.

In integration of three networks transition period, communicate to connect and have following several call case:
1) if call object is the ISSN user terminal in three nets, comprise this locality or nonlocal ISSN user terminal, store in the Query Database of operating side by behind the integration of three networks number related information of calling terminal, in ISSN, set up a signalling path, set up a content channel for calling terminal with by calling terminal on the internet, therefore calling interface channel in three nets is all based on the Internet, and the communication in three nets is called out local or the other places all is free no matter be.
2) if the object that local ISSN user terminal is called out is local pstn telephone network users terminal, then calling terminal is directly sent calling by the pstn telephone net, is equivalent to common local pstn telephone net telephone service this moment.
3) if the object of local pstn telephone network users terminal call is local ISSN user terminal, then calling terminal is directly sent calling by the pstn telephone net, is equivalent to common local pstn telephone net telephone service this moment.
4) if calling party is nonlocal ISSN user terminal, the called party is local pstn telephone network users terminal, then run the ISSN user terminal that signaling platform selects to share among the group to a user gateway of this locality and send instruction, by forming the forward gateway between its inner internet interface of the user gateway subsystem controls in this ISSN user terminal and the pstn telephone network interface, make and form between nonlocal ISSN user terminal and the local pstn telephone network users terminal: the Internet is to the communication path of local pstn telephone net, thereby can be in order to avoid long-distance telephone expenses only need be paid local telephone expenses.
5) if local pstn telephone network users terminal ISSN user terminal clawback outwards, send instruction by an ISSN user terminal of selecting to share among the group by the operation signaling platform equally to a user gateway of this locality, form reverse gateway between the pstn telephone network interface of portion and the internet interface within it by the user gateway subsystem controls of this ISSN user terminal, make and form between local pstn telephone network users terminal and the nonlocal ISSN user terminal: local pstn telephone net can be exempted from long-distance telephone expenses equally to the communication path of the Internet.
